OS Distribution
As of the Wallaby 10.0.0 release, Kayobe supports multiple Operating
System (OS) distributions. See the support matrix <support-matrix-supported-os>
for
a list of supported OS distributions. The same OS distribution should be
used throughout the system.
The os_distribution
variable in
etc/kayobe/globals.yml
can be used to set the OS
distribution to use. It may be set to either centos
or or
rocky
or ubuntu
, and defaults to
centos
.
The os_release
variable in
etc/kayobe/globals.yml
can be used to set the release of
the OS. When os_distribution
is set to centos
it may be set to 8-stream
, and this is its default value.
When os_distribution
is set to ubuntu
it may
be set to jammy
, and this is its default value. When
os_distribution
is set to rocky
it may be set
to 8
, and this is its default value.
These variables are used to set various defaults, including:
- Bootstrap users
- Overcloud host root disk image build configuration
- Seed VM root disk image
- Kolla base container image
Example: using Ubuntu
In the following example, we set the OS distribution to
ubuntu
:
os_distribution: "ubuntu"
Example: using Rocky
In the following example, we set the OS distribution to
rocky
:
os_distribution: "rocky"
